The Best Child-Friendly Dog Breeds

Choosing the best child-friendly dog for your family is an important decision, as the right breed can provide companionship, protection, and endless joy. Some dogs are naturally more patient, gentle, and affectionate, making them ideal for homes with children. In this guide, we will explore ten of the best child-friendly dog breeds in the UK, highlighting their temperaments, care needs, and why they make fantastic family pets.

Beagle – The Playful and Energetic Family Companion

Beagles are small to medium-sized dogs with a friendly and affectionate nature, making them one of the best child-friendly dogs. Their playful temperament ensures they are always up for a game, and their strong sense of loyalty makes them excellent companions for children. Beagles are intelligent and curious, which means they require plenty of mental and physical stimulation.

They are generally very social and get along well with other pets. However, because they are scent hounds, they can be prone to following their noses, so a secure garden and consistent training are necessary. Beagles thrive in active households and love spending time outdoors, making them great for families who enjoy walking and exploring.

Labrador Retriever – The Ultimate Family Dog

Labrador Retrievers consistently rank as one of the best child-friendly dogs due to their gentle, friendly, and obedient nature. Labs are highly intelligent and easy to train, making them ideal for families, even those who have never owned a dog before.

They are incredibly patient and affectionate, forming strong bonds with children and adults alike. Labradors have a playful side and require regular exercise to keep them healthy and happy. Their love for water means they will happily join in family beach trips or swim sessions. Labs shed moderately and require regular grooming, but their short, dense coat is relatively easy to maintain.

Newfoundland – The Gentle Giant

Newfoundlands are large, fluffy dogs known for their calm, loving, and protective nature. Often called “nanny dogs,” they have a natural instinct to care for children and are incredibly patient, making them one of the best child-friendly dogs.

Despite their size, Newfoundlands are gentle and affectionate, always eager to please their owners. They are excellent swimmers and were originally bred for water rescues. Their thick coat requires frequent brushing to prevent matting, but their affectionate temperament and loyalty make them worth the effort. While they need space due to their size, they are generally calm indoors and enjoy lounging with their family.

French Bulldog – The Compact and Loving Companion

French Bulldogs are small, sturdy dogs with a big personality, making them perfect for families with children. They are affectionate, playful, and adaptable, thriving in both large homes and small apartments. Frenchies do not require excessive exercise, making them suitable for busy households.

They are known for their comical expressions and loving nature, forming strong attachments to their families. French Bulldogs are generally quiet dogs, making them an excellent choice for homes in busy neighbourhoods or flats. Their short coat is low-maintenance, but they can be prone to overheating, so care should be taken in hot weather.

Irish Setter – The Energetic and Affectionate Playmate

Irish Setters are known for their striking red coats and lively personalities. They are friendly, intelligent, and full of energy, making them great playmates for active children. Irish Setters thrive in households where they receive plenty of exercise and mental stimulation.

They are very social dogs and enjoy the company of both humans and other animals. Their affectionate nature means they bond closely with their family and love being involved in all activities. Their long, silky coat requires regular brushing to prevent tangles, but their loving and fun-loving personality makes them one of the best child-friendly dogs.

Collie – The Intelligent and Loyal Guardian

Collies are one of the most intelligent and trainable dog breeds, making them fantastic companions for children. Whether it’s a Rough Collie (like Lassie) or a Border Collie, these dogs are highly loyal and protective of their families.

They thrive on companionship and are happiest when given a job to do. Collies are gentle, patient, and rarely aggressive, making them ideal for families. However, they do require plenty of mental and physical stimulation. Their long coats need regular grooming, but their affectionate and devoted nature makes them well worth the effort.

Pug – The Small but Lovable Family Clown

Pugs are known for their adorable wrinkled faces and playful personalities. These small dogs are full of charm and love to be around people, making them great companions for children. They are affectionate, friendly, and thrive on attention, always seeking to be the centre of family activities.

Pugs have moderate exercise needs and are content with short walks and playtime. Their short coats are low-maintenance, but they can be prone to respiratory issues due to their flat faces. They are happiest when surrounded by their family and love nothing more than curling up on the sofa for a cuddle.

Bulldog – The Gentle and Easygoing Companion

Bulldogs are one of the most relaxed and affectionate breeds, making them one of the best child-friendly dogs. They are sturdy, patient, and incredibly loving, forming strong bonds with children. Their calm and easygoing nature makes them great for families of all sizes.

Despite their stocky appearance, Bulldogs do not require excessive exercise and are happy with short walks and play sessions. Their short coat is easy to maintain, but they can be prone to overheating and require special attention during hot weather. Their affectionate and protective personality makes them a fantastic addition to any family.

Brussels Griffon – The Loyal and Playful Little Friend

The Brussels Griffon is a small but spirited breed known for its expressive face and affectionate nature. These dogs are full of personality and love being around people, making them excellent companions for children. They are intelligent and easy to train, responding well to positive reinforcement.

Brussels Griffons are playful and energetic but do not require excessive exercise, making them suitable for both large homes and apartments. Their wiry coat requires regular grooming, but their charming and affectionate personality makes them a joy to have in any family.

Golden Retriever – The Affectionate and Intelligent Family Favourite

Golden Retrievers are one of the most popular family dogs in the UK and for good reason. They are intelligent, gentle, and incredibly affectionate, making them one of the best child-friendly dogs. Goldens are easy to train and highly sociable, thriving in a family environment.

They are excellent with children and other pets, always eager to please and participate in family activities. Their long, thick coat requires regular grooming, but their loving nature and playful personality make them well worth the effort. Goldens are active dogs who enjoy outdoor adventures, making them a great match for families who love spending time outside.

Choosing the Best Child-Friendly Dog for Your Family

When selecting the best child-friendly dog, it’s important to consider factors such as size, energy levels, grooming needs, and temperament. All of the dog breeds listed above are known for their affectionate and gentle nature, making them excellent choices for families and child-friendly. Whether you prefer a playful Beagle, a devoted Labrador Retriever, or a gentle Newfoundland, there is a perfect dog for every household.
